Web21 oct. 2024 · Generally: both SOCs have 10 compute cores: 8 performance and 2 efficiency, 16 core neural link chip, and graphic cores. Major difference with the M1 Max is the graphic cores. M1 Pro has up to 16-cores while the M1 Max has 32-cores in varying degrees of yield. Web31 oct. 2024 · Configuration tested: M1 Max, 10-core CPU, 32-core GPU, 32GB unified memory, 1TB storage. The displays on the 14-inch and 16-inch MacBook Pro have rounded corners at the top. When measured as a standard rectangular shape, the screens are 14.2 inches and 16.2 inches diagonally (actual viewable area is less).
